I've been investing in the city of Wilkes Barre for 12 years now and reside in Miami Florida. I seen a lot of changes, and all for the better. Properties are very cheap and there's lots of demand for rentals, at least for my units. One reason is because of all the people moving in from NY, NJ and other Major cities and near by towns.
Here I'll tell you how I created my own team for managing my properties.
1: Since I only have 6 units, I'm the property manager and I receive all the tenants calls and complaints. Good TIP, NEVER EVER tell your tenants you are the owner.
2: I have a very good and responsible handyman very close to my properties who takes care of all the issues that may arise. Normally they are small things, because we remodel the whole property. He does my showings, cleaning and giving access to any utility company that needs to enter the property.
3: I have another friend in the area that I assigned to do the eviction process, like filing the documents in court and attending on our behalf.
4: And last, I have a constable that I normally use when eviction is a must, it's very rare, even in the areas that I invest which is what they call the heights.
